Welcome to on-call for the Glimmerpane design system! Our snapshot tests live in the `snapcheck` suite and run on every merge to main. If a UI component changes visually, the diff bot flags it — usually it's an intentional tweak, so just approve the new baseline. If it's 2am and snapshots are failing across the board, it's almost always a font-loading race, not your problem. To unlock the baseline store and re-approve snapshots in bulk, use the recovery passphrase below.

recovery phrase for tahag-taguf: wenix-caswyn

# Build Provenance: Keyturn Secrets-Rotation Utility

Keyturn rotates service credentials across the Fernbeck clusters on a six-hour cadence. Each rotation run is built from a pinned commit, and the provenance manifest records the compiler version, dependency lockfile hash, and signing identity. On-call engineers responding to rotation failures should verify the running binary matches the last attested build before restarting the scheduler. The current attested build token is listed directly below.

session token of yahof-bajeg = htk9_0d43d44ed

Subject: Quickstore 4.2 — bloom filter now fronts the KV layer

Plugin authors: starting with this release, Quickstore places a bloom filter ahead of the key-value store. Negative lookups return faster; false positives fall through safely. No API changes are required on your side. Verify your plugin against the staging build referenced below.

session token of fahif-tadup = htk3_9c7

Subject: Key rotation for GiftLeaf receipt mailer

Heads up before you review PR 1142: we rotated the credential the GiftLeaf donation-receipt mailer uses to call the Postbird send service. The old key is revoked as of this morning, so any stale config will fail. The new key for staging is below.

gateway credential: qvz7-vWy80ME

### Action Item: Spoolhaven Retry Storm

From last Tuesday's outage: the Spoolhaven print service retried failed jobs without backoff, saturating the render pool. Fix merged; retries now use capped exponential backoff with jitter. Owner will monitor for a week before closing. The agreed retry constants are recorded below.

constants for yadup-kajof:
RATE_LIMITS = {
    "zorwyn": 1,
    "druwyn": 1,
}